Uneven pavement repair services focus on addressing surface irregularities such as cracks, potholes, and surface depressions in asphalt or concrete surfaces. These services typically involve the removal of damaged or deteriorated pavement sections, followed by the installation of new material to restore a smooth, level surface. The process may include patching, leveling, or resurfacing techniques designed to improve the overall condition of the pavement and extend its lifespan. Skilled service providers use specialized equipment and materials to ensure a seamless repair that blends with the existing surface.
This type of repair helps solve common pavement problems that can pose safety hazards and lead to further deterioration if left unaddressed. Uneven surfaces can cause trips, falls, and vehicle damage, especially for pedestrians, cyclists, and drivers. Additionally, potholes and cracks can allow water infiltration, which accelerates the breakdown of the pavement and underlying foundation. Repairing uneven pavement not only enhances safety but also prevents more costly repairs in the future by maintaining the integrity of the surface.

What causes uneven pavement? Uneven pavement can result from soil movement, poor installation, weather conditions, or underlying ground settling. Identifying the cause helps determine the best repair approach.
How do professionals repair uneven pavement? Repair methods may include leveling, grinding, or replacing damaged sections to restore a smooth, even surface.
How long does uneven pavement repair typically take? The duration varies depending on the extent of the damage and the chosen repair method, but most projects can be completed within a few hours to a day.
Is uneven pavement repair suitable for all types of pavement surfaces? Many pavement types, including concrete and asphalt, can be repaired for unevenness, though the specific method depends on the surface material.
